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M1BP4_Moderate
The NM_003640.5(ELP1):c.3527G>A(p.Ser1176Asn) variant causes a missense change. The variant allele was found at a frequency of 0.000146 in 1,614,054 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★).

This sequence change replaces serine, which is neutral and polar, with asparagine, which is neutral and polar, at codon 1176 of the ELP1 protein (p.Ser1176Asn). This variant is present in population databases (rs749668335, gnomAD 0.009%). This variant has not been reported in the literature in individuals affected with ELP1-related conditions. ClinVar contains an entry for this variant (Variation ID: 568643). Invitae Evidence Mod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) indicates that this missense variant is expected to disrupt ELP1 protein function with a positive predictive value of 80%.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
Not observed at significant frequency in large population cohorts (gnomAD); In silico analysis indicates that this missense variant does not alter protein structure/function; Has not been previously published as pathogenic or benign to our knowledge -

The c.3527G>A (p.S1176N) alteration is located in exon 33 (coding exon 32) of the IKBKAP gene. This alteration results from a G to A substitution at nucleotide position 3527, causing the serine (S) at amino acid position 1176 to be replaced by an asparagine (N).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
